I bought it in 1988, these were the ones they rebarreled to .308. I bought it because I was going hunting with a friend , whose property was in a "Rifle County"and the price was right.(I hunted in a shotgun only county) The gun shot well, and I took 2 deer with it, But it wasn't a pretty gun. A couple of years later, I inherited a Winchester Model 88 and the old mauser didn't get much use. This spring, I decided to give it a face lift. Now that I finally got the scope mounted, I can take it out this weekend and get reaquainted. (hope the picture shows up)

Very nice pictures and thanks for sharing. I would be caution shooting hot .308 Winchester leads in a rifle based on a Model 1893 Mauser action (which is not as strong as a '98 Mauser action). Just the idle thoughts of an idle fellow. Take care...

Thank You Joe.
I load reduced loads for this gun to be on the safe side. It doesn't get a lot of use, but I like to take it to the range every so often and shoot 20- 30 rounds with it.
